## What Are the Requirements to Travel Insurance in Europe?

**Introduction**

Travel insurance is a type of insurance that provides coverage for unexpected events that can occur during your trip, such as medical emergencies, lost luggage, or trip cancellations. If you are planning a trip to Europe, it is important to purchase travel insurance to protect yourself from these unforeseen circumstances.

**Other requirements**

In addition to the general requirements listed above, some insurance providers may also require you to meet other requirements, such as:

* **Medical history**
* **Age**
* **Destination**

**Medical history**

If you have any pre-existing medical conditions, you may be required to provide information about your medical history to the insurance provider. This information will help the provider to determine if you are eligible for coverage and the premium you will pay.

**Age**

Some insurance providers may have age restrictions on their policies. For example, some providers may only offer coverage to travelers who are under the age of 65.

**Destination**

The destination of your trip may also affect the coverage you need and the premium you will pay. For example, if you are traveling to a country with a high risk of medical emergencies, you may need to purchase additional coverage.

**What are the benefits of travel insurance?**

Travel insurance can provide you with a variety of benefits, such as:

* **Peace of mind**
* **Financial protection**
* **Medical coverage**
* **Luggage coverage**
* **Trip cancellation coverage**

**Peace of mind**

Travel insurance can give you peace of mind knowing that you are protected from unexpected events that can occur during your trip.

**Financial protection**

Travel insurance can help you to protect your finances from unexpected expenses, such as medical emergencies or lost luggage.

**Medical coverage**

Travel insurance can provide you with medical coverage in the event of an injury or illness while traveling.

**Luggage coverage**

Travel insurance can provide you with coverage for lost, stolen, or damaged luggage.

**Trip cancellation coverage**

Travel insurance can provide you with coverage for trip cancellations due to unforeseen circumstances, such as illness or natural disasters.
